In 21st century, people are faced two problems: energy crisis and worsened environment. The countermeasures of sustainable use of energy resources are put forward.Along with the development of automobile industry and the rapid increase of automobile amount, the environmental problem is even worse. To develop green-vehicle is the growing trend in automotive technology. In recent years, the application of gas-vehicle has been popularized.Liquefied petroleum gas (LPG) is a mixture of butane and propane. A specific feature of these hydrocarbons is that they can turn to liquid even at room temperature and at relatively low pressure (about 0.5~1MPa). Liquefied petroleum gas can be easily stored and transported in a liquid state with high energy density. The vehicles that run on liquefied petroleum gas have fewer combustion deposits and lower emissions based on present-day legislation, and the throttles aren't reduced. For its technical advantages in comparison with diesel/petrol engine, dual-fuel engine is widely used.In this paper the research work has been put on the Model 490Q engine by changing the diesel/LPG dual-fuel technique through using ECU to control the air feed mode of the inlet channel blender. Contrastive test results of performance can be obtained when separately using diesel and diesel/LPG dual-fuel.The result shows that when using diesel/LPG dual-fuel the engine's power is increased .At low-load the economy viability of the dual-fuel engine is better than the diesel engine, however at high-load the diesel engine is better. As for the exhaust emission, the smoke level is considerably decreased, and NOx emission level is debased also.
